Masco Corporation (MAS) has shown consistent performance, beating earnings estimates and delivering solid quarterly dividends. Their Q2 earnings reported an increase in sales, leading to a
10.6% stock jump. Their resilience and strategic capital allocation have been identified as strong drivers of shareholder value. However, challenges persist, including tariff-induced cost pressures leading to a cautious market sentiment. Their Q1 earnings and revenue were lower than expected, dampening optimism. Despite these dynamics, the company's stock continues to trade up. There have been management reshuffles, including the appointment of
Jonathon Nudi as new CEO. The company also agreed on terms with their retired CEO Allman. Insiders have been selling stock leading to potential bearish signals. Operational efficiency and smart capital allocation have driven value, indicating robustness in the cyclical sector. The company has navigated market challenges and tariffs well, as seen in their Q1 2025 presentation. Their performance has even outpaced sector rivals on some trading days.
